Employing WhatsApp via your PC – A Quick Guide

Want to connect with your friends and family outside of your smartphone? Using WhatsApp Web is a surprisingly straightforward procedure. Simply navigate to your favorite web browser, such as Chrome, Firefox, or Safari, and visit web.whatsapp.com. You’’re then prompted to use camera at the QR code displayed on your phone’’s WhatsApp application. Select the "WhatsApp Web" setting in your phone's menu (usually found in the three dots in the upper right corner). Position your phone’s camera carefully to the QR code, and during moments, your WhatsApp messages will show up directly on your display. And that’s it! Now you can relay and receive messages, share photos, and make calls directly from your machine.

Fixing WhatsApp Web Problems

Encountering frustrating performance with this platform on your browser? You're not alone! Several frequent problems can arise. First, verify your network is stable - a dropped connection is a frequent culprit. Next, attempt clearing your browser's cache and cookies; this often resolves many minor faults. If that doesn't succeed, consider restarting your browser entirely. Yet another likely fix is to log out from the service on your computer and then sign in again. Finally, make sure you're using a compatible browser version – outdated versions can sometimes cause operational problems.

WhatsApp Browser vs. WhatsApp Computer: What's the Distinction?

Many users are confused about the subtle differences between WhatsApp Web and WhatsApp Desktop. While both allow you to access your WhatsApp account on a larger screen, they operate in distinct ways. WhatsApp Web, sometimes referred to as WhatsApp Online, is essentially a browser-based version of the application that runs within your online browser like Chrome, Firefox, or Safari. It requires your phone to remain active to the internet because it mirrors your mobile device’s application. Conversely, WhatsApp Desktop is a independent application that you get directly onto your computer. This application can function even if your phone is not actively connected, as it keeps data locally. Ultimately, WhatsApp Desktop offers a slightly more robust experience, particularly regarding features like message posting when your phone is offline, while WhatsApp Web is a convenient option for quick access without installation.
